Request parameters:
- long organisationId - organisation id
- Employee employee - employee
/// Employee details. public class
Employee
{
// Employee id. // Ignored on create request. public long EmployeeId { get; set; }
// Employee code. public string Code { get; set; }
// Employee Tax number. public string TaxNumber { get; set; }
// Employee first name. public string FirstName { get; set; }
// Employee last name. public string LastName { get; set; }
// Employee address. public string Address { get; set; }
// Employee postal code. public string PostalCode { get; set; }
// Employee city. public string City { get; set; }
// Employee country. public
mMApiFkField Country { get; set; }
// Employee residence country. public
mMApiFkField CountryOfResidence { get; set; }
// Employee date of birth. public DateTime? DateOfBirth { get; set; }
// Employee gender:
// <ul>
//     <li>M - Man</li>
//     <li>Z - Woman</li>
// </ul>
// public string Gender { get; set; }
// Date of employment. public DateTime? EmploymentStartDate { get; set; }
// Employment end date. public DateTime? EmploymentEndDate { get; set; }
// Notes. public string Notes { get; set; }
// Employment type:
// <ul>
//     <li>ZD - Employed worker</li>
//     <li>SSD - A regular seasonal worker</li>
//     <li>SZ - The self-employed</li>
//     <li>CU - A board member and an executive director</li>
//     <li>VO - A volunteer</li>
//     <li>PENZ - Pensioner</li>
//     <li>ZAP - Employed elsewhere</li>
//     <li>DD - Seconded worker</li>
// </ul>
// public string EmploymentType { get; set; }
// Employee Personal identification number. public string PersonalIdenficationNumber { get; set; }
// Employee Insurance base for employment type SZ and organisation type »Obrtnik«:
// <ul>
//     <li>OB – Craft,</li>
//     <li>SZ - Liberal professions,</li>
//     <li>SP - An athlete,</li>
//     <li>PG - A farmer and a forester,</li>
//     <li>SD - Other independent business activities,</li>
//     <li>SU - Freelance artists</li>
// </ul> public string InsuranceBasis { get; set; }
public DateTime RecordDtModified { get; set; }
// Row version is used for concurrency check. // Ignored on create request. public string RowVersion { get; set; }
}
/// Link with id, name and url to related data. public class
mMApiFkField
{
// Record id. public long? ID { get; set; }
// Record name. public string Name { get; private set; }
// Url to full record details. public string ResourceUrl { get; private set; }
}
Request parameters:
- Int64 organisationId - organisation id
- Employee employee - employee
/// Employee details. class
Employee
{
// Employee id. // Ignored on create request. public $EmployeeId;
// Employee code. public $Code;
// Employee Tax number. public $TaxNumber;
// Employee first name. public $FirstName;
// Employee last name. public $LastName;
// Employee address. public $Address;
// Employee postal code. public $PostalCode;
// Employee city. public $City;
// Employee country. public $Country;
// Employee residence country. public $CountryOfResidence;
// Employee date of birth. public $DateOfBirth;
// Employee gender:
// <ul>
//     <li>M - Man</li>
//     <li>Z - Woman</li>
// </ul>
// public $Gender;
// Date of employment. public $EmploymentStartDate;
// Employment end date. public $EmploymentEndDate;
// Notes. public $Notes;
// Employment type:
// <ul>
//     <li>ZD - Employed worker</li>
//     <li>SSD - A regular seasonal worker</li>
//     <li>SZ - The self-employed</li>
//     <li>CU - A board member and an executive director</li>
//     <li>VO - A volunteer</li>
//     <li>PENZ - Pensioner</li>
//     <li>ZAP - Employed elsewhere</li>
//     <li>DD - Seconded worker</li>
// </ul>
// public $EmploymentType;
// Employee Personal identification number. public $PersonalIdenficationNumber;
// Employee Insurance base for employment type SZ and organisation type »Obrtnik«:
// <ul>
//     <li>OB – Craft,</li>
//     <li>SZ - Liberal professions,</li>
//     <li>SP - An athlete,</li>
//     <li>PG - A farmer and a forester,</li>
//     <li>SD - Other independent business activities,</li>
//     <li>SU - Freelance artists</li>
// </ul> public $InsuranceBasis;
public $RecordDtModified;
// Row version is used for concurrency check. // Ignored on create request. public $RowVersion;
}
/// Link with id, name and url to related data. class
mMApiFkField
{
// Record id. public $ID;
// Record name. public $Name;
// Url to full record details. public $ResourceUrl;
}
Request parameters:
- Long organisationId - organisation id
- Employee employee - employee
/// Employee details. public class
Employee
{
// Employee id. // Ignored on create request. public Long EmployeeId;
// Employee code. public String Code;
// Employee Tax number. public String TaxNumber;
// Employee first name. public String FirstName;
// Employee last name. public String LastName;
// Employee address. public String Address;
// Employee postal code. public String PostalCode;
// Employee city. public String City;
// Employee country. public
mMApiFkField Country;
// Employee residence country. public
mMApiFkField CountryOfResidence;
// Employee date of birth. public Date DateOfBirth;
// Employee gender:
// <ul>
//     <li>M - Man</li>
//     <li>Z - Woman</li>
// </ul>
// public String Gender;
// Date of employment. public Date EmploymentStartDate;
// Employment end date. public Date EmploymentEndDate;
// Notes. public String Notes;
// Employment type:
// <ul>
//     <li>ZD - Employed worker</li>
//     <li>SSD - A regular seasonal worker</li>
//     <li>SZ - The self-employed</li>
//     <li>CU - A board member and an executive director</li>
//     <li>VO - A volunteer</li>
//     <li>PENZ - Pensioner</li>
//     <li>ZAP - Employed elsewhere</li>
//     <li>DD - Seconded worker</li>
// </ul>
// public String EmploymentType;
// Employee Personal identification number. public String PersonalIdenficationNumber;
// Employee Insurance base for employment type SZ and organisation type »Obrtnik«:
// <ul>
//     <li>OB – Craft,</li>
//     <li>SZ - Liberal professions,</li>
//     <li>SP - An athlete,</li>
//     <li>PG - A farmer and a forester,</li>
//     <li>SD - Other independent business activities,</li>
//     <li>SU - Freelance artists</li>
// </ul> public String InsuranceBasis;
public Date RecordDtModified;
// Row version is used for concurrency check. // Ignored on create request. public String RowVersion;
}
/// Link with id, name and url to related data. public class
mMApiFkField
{
// Record id. public Long ID;
// Record name. public String Name;
// Url to full record details. public String ResourceUrl;
}